Eventually, Hollingshead's patent was ruled invalid in 1950 and therefore anyone could open a drive-in theater without having to pay royalties to Hollingshead for his patent. flax seeds powder with milkWebWhen they bought cars, most had to go to white car dealerships. Until 1940, when Ed Davis opened up a Studebaker dealership in Detroit, there were no black-owned car dealerships in the United States.
